The SimpleMathJax3 extension enables MathJax v3 for typesetting TeX formula in MediaWiki inside math environments.

Setting name | Default value | Description |
---|---|---|
$wgSmjScale |
1.0 |
Use chtml font scale |
$wgSmjUseCDN |
true |
Use CDN or local scripts |
$wgSmjUseChem |
true |
Enable chem tag |
$wgSmjInlineMath |
[["\\(","\\)"]] |
Inline math symbols pairs |
$wgSmjDisplayMath |
[["\\[","\\]"],["$$","$$"]] |
Display math symbols pairs |
$wgSmjShowMathMenu |
true |
Enable MathJax context menu |
$wgSmjConvertMath |
true |
Converts [<math> ,</math> ] to [\( ,\) ] on load |
$wgSmjConvertStyle |
"displaystyle" |
Default style for unspecified <math> conversion. Options: ["displaystyle" , "textstyle" ] |
$wgSmjConvertMath
will allow you to use your existing LaTeX math without editing your mediawiki pages. However, this will prevent you from using the MathML syntax with MathJax.- Do not use
$wgSmjConvertMath
with the Visual Editor if you want to keep<math>
elements.
